Jekyll2023-09-29T12:37:56+09:00/classes/feed.xmlClasses - K. Wakita担当科目(脇田 建)wakitaリンク2021-09-21T00:00:00+09:002021-09-21T00:00:00+09:00/classes/2021/09/21/link<h1 id="リンク-ken-wakita-2021-09-21">リンク (Ken Wakita, 2021-09-21)</h1>
<p>リンクの貼り方について悩んだ。いくつかの設定と Jekyll のバージョンが絡んだ問題だったようだ。</p>
<ul>
<li><code class="language-plaintext highlighter-rouge">baseurl</code> と <code class="language-plaintext highlighter-rouge">url</code> の設定:なにかの例を見て <code class="language-plaintext highlighter-rouge">url</code> に GitHub の URL を設定していたが、それを空にした。
<div class="language-plaintext highlighter-rouge"><div class="highlight"><pre class="highlight"><code> baseurl: "/classes"
url: ""
</code></pre></div> </div>
</li>
<li>
<p><a href="https://jekyllrb.com/docs/liquid/tags/#links">Jekyll V4.0 以降ではリンクの設定が簡素化され</a>、<code class="language-plaintext highlighter-rouge">site.baseurl</code> の参照が不要になったとドキュメントに書かれている。ということは、それより古いバージョンの Jekyll を利用している場合はこれを明示すべきなのだろう。</p>
<pre><code class="language-{.md}"> ここにある[各クラスの第4クォーターの内容説明](/classes/years/y21/cs2/course.html)を読んで
</code></pre>
<p>なぜ、手元の Jekyll のバージョンが 3.9.0 と古いのかは不明。</p>
</li>
</ul>Ken Wakitaリンク (Ken Wakita, 2021-09-21)